Everything You Need to Know About Chain Link Fencing: A Comprehensive Guide
When it comes to security, durability, and versatility, few fencing options can rival the reliable chain link fence. Whether you're looking to secure a residential property, a commercial space, or a public area, chain link fencing offers an affordable and effective solution. In this blog, we'll delve into the advantages of chain link fences, their various applications, and why they remain a popular choice for fencing needs around the world.
Chain link fencing, also known as cyclone or diamond-mesh fencing, consists of woven steel wire that forms a diamond pattern. It is typically mounted on posts made of steel, aluminum, or wood, creating a sturdy barrier that can stand the test of time. The design of chain link fences allows for strength, flexibility, and visibility, making them ideal for a wide variety of uses.
Chain link fences are often coated with a protective layer of zinc, known as galvanizing, to prevent rust and ensure the fence lasts for many years. This protective coating is available in different forms, such as:
Galvanized (G90): Steel wires are coated with a layer of zinc for increased durability.
Vinyl-Coated: A vinyl coating is applied over galvanized wire for added protection against weather elements and to give the fence a more polished appearance.
There are several reasons why chain link fences are a go-to solution for both residential and commercial fencing needs. Here are some of the most significant benefits:
Affordability
Chain link fences are often more budget-friendly than other fencing materials, such as wood or vinyl. Their affordability makes them an attractive option for large-scale projects, where cost is a major consideration.
Durability
One of the most significant advantages of chain link fences is their exceptional durability. Made of galvanized steel, chain link fences can withstand harsh weather conditions, including rain, snow, and intense sunlight. The zinc coating helps prevent rust and corrosion, making the fence resistant to wear and tear.
Low Maintenance
Compared to wooden fences, chain link fences require very little maintenance. They don't need to be painted or treated with preservatives. Simply inspect them periodically to ensure there is no damage or sagging, and you'll enjoy a secure boundary for years to come.
Security
Chain link fences provide a reliable security barrier. Their tall, sturdy design prevents easy climbing, and they can be enhanced with additional features such as razor wire or barbed wire for added protection. For commercial properties or high-security areas, chain link fences offer an excellent solution.
Visibility
One of the unique features of chain link fencing is that it allows visibility through the mesh. While it provides a clear boundary, it doesn't obstruct the view like solid wooden fences or concrete walls do. This can be an essential factor in both residential and commercial applications.
Versatility
Chain link fences come in a range of heights, gauges, and coatings, making them suitable for various needs. Whether you're protecting your garden from animals or securing a large industrial property, you can customize the fence to meet your specific requirements.
Chain link fences are not limited to one specific application; they are widely used across different industries and residential spaces. Here are some of the most common uses:
Residential Fencing
Chain link fences are an affordable and reliable choice for homeowners looking to secure their property. They are often used to enclose backyards, gardens, and driveways. Since they provide visibility, they’re also useful for areas where aesthetic appeal isn’t a primary concern, such as backyard pet enclosures or pool fences.
Commercial Fencing
Businesses, warehouses, and factories often use chain link fences for security and privacy. The design allows for quick installation, and the fence can be made tall enough to deter intruders. Additionally, it can be customized with privacy slats to shield the interior from view.
Sports Facilities
Chain link fences are commonly seen around sports fields, tennis courts, and playgrounds. They keep spectators at a safe distance and protect the area from unwanted animals or trespassers.
Industrial and Agricultural Fencing
In industrial and agricultural settings, chain link fences are used to secure large areas of land, factories, or even agricultural fields. The durability of the fence ensures that it can handle rough conditions, such as exposure to chemicals or agricultural machinery.
Installing a chain link fence is a relatively simple process, making it a popular choice for both professional contractors and DIY enthusiasts. Here are the basic steps involved:
Planning and Measuring
Start by determining the length of fence you need and marking out the boundaries of your fence. Take accurate measurements to ensure the correct number of posts and rolls of chain link mesh.
Setting Posts
Dig post holes at regular intervals along your boundary line. The posts should be spaced 6-10 feet apart, depending on the size of the fence and the level of security you desire. The holes should be deep enough to securely anchor the posts in place.
Attaching the Mesh
Once the posts are set, unroll the chain link mesh along the fence line. Secure the mesh to the posts using tension bands and tie wires, ensuring it’s tight and taut.
Finishing Touches
Add any desired features, such as gates, barbed wire, or privacy slats. Finish the installation by trimming excess mesh and securing the fence at the end points.
While chain link fences are low-maintenance, there are a few things you can do to extend their lifespan:
Regular Cleaning: Periodically wash the fence with soap and water to remove dirt and grime. If the fence is located in a particularly dusty area, you may want to clean it more often.
Check for Damage: Inspect the fence periodically for any signs of damage, such as bent posts or broken wires. Addressing minor issues early can help prevent more extensive repairs later on.
Repainting or Resealing: If you have a vinyl-coated chain link fence, repainting or resealing it can help preserve its appearance and protect it from the elements.
